Here in Peru I can get nice looking locally produced leather holsters designed to fit specific guns, but I suspect the tanning process is not likely to be up to the likes of Galco, etc, and all my handguns are blued. I wonder if they might produce rust over a period of time, especially in a humid environment.

So that leaves me with a choice between Fobus, and the Uncle Mikes/Gunmate universal, nylon offerings for both IWB and OWB.

The three round studs at the top of the Fobus holsters, which the gun has to be drawn past worry me. It looks like they might scratch some of the blueing off my guns over time.

Are the universal nylon/polyester types reasonable, or should I stay away from them? They appear to be well padded, but do they provide any protection against body sweat during the summer months?

Personally, I would go with the local leather if it is molded to fit properly. Remove the firearm from the leather for storage when you are not carrying it. If humidity is real bad, keep it wiped down to preserve the finish and repel moisture. I like the Remington gun wipes that come in the individual packets but you can also get small canisters that look similar to baby wipes for frequent and fast use.

I use only top USA vegetable tanned leather but still advise not to store your gun or knife in its holster or sheath. No sense in inviting trouble.
